倍可親

回復: 0
列印 上一主題 下一主題

百花爭艷 Windows Server五大版本該如何選擇

[複製鏈接]

859

主題

1038

帖子

776

積分

貝殼網友六級

Rank: 3Rank: 3

積分
776
跳轉到指定樓層
樓主
Windows每推出一個伺服器版本,會根據用戶需求的不同,同時推出幾個不同的伺服器版本。如以WindowsServer2008為例,其就同時推出了標準版、企業版、數據中心版、Web伺服器版和伺服器核心版本。這五個版本雖然其核心功能是相同的,其主要的差異在與系統的相關配置上。簡單的說,不同的版本就好像提供了不同的配置文件。在實際工作中,根據伺服器的用途來選擇合適的伺服器版本,就顯得尤其的重要。因為伺服器配置的不同,直接關係到應用伺服器的性能與安全。那麼這五個伺服器版本到底有什麼差異呢?我們系統管理員又該如何選擇呢?且聽筆者一一道來。



  一、標準版。

  標準版其實就是一個通用的版本,可以用於各種不同的用途。簡單的說,就是沒有任何特色的地方。在實現某個應用程序時,與其他版本相比起來,往往需要更多的配置。在實際工作中,標準版本是最常見的伺服器操作系統版本。通常情況下,標準版本可以支持域控制器、實用程序伺服器、文件伺服器、列印伺服器、媒體伺服器等等。對於中小企業來說,標準版本的功能已經能夠滿足大部分網路的需求。不過需要注意的是,與其他版本相比,標準版本還是在某些方面受到一定的限制。

  一是其所支持的核心處理器的數量受到限制。以WindowsServer2008為例,其支持的核心處理器數量高達四個。而數據中心版的核心處理器數量則高達八個。由於標準版其處理器的數量有限,為此其上面部署的應用程序的數量也可能受到限制。如果只部署一個或者兩個應用程序,並且客戶端數量比較少的話,四個處理器已經能夠滿足需求。但是如果客戶端數量比較多,或者在同一個伺服器上需要部署多個應用程序,此時四個核心處理器可能就無法滿足需求了。

  二是在數據的處理上,也會受到一定的限制。從某種程度上來說,標準版並不能夠適用於需要大規模處理能力和內存能力的相關應用。如群集或者活動目錄聯合等相關的伺服器。在實際工作中,筆者一般建議在標準版上實現DNS或者DHCP等簡單的網路應用。而相對於SQLServer等需要大量數據處理的應用,並不建議適用標準版本,而是使用伺服器版本或者數據中心版本等等。

  二、企業版。

  企業版本與標準版本相比,其突出的優勢在於大規模的處理能力和內存能力。通常情況下,支持伺服器群集的企業版能夠向機構提供高可用性環境要求的真正的每周7天、每天24個小時且正常工作概率達到99.99%的不間斷服務。簡單的說,就是可以提供非常高的可用性。而且企業版本能夠支持大範圍的各種日常使用的伺服器系統。在選擇企業版時,需要注意如下內容。

  一是需要注意伺服器標準版本與企業版本之間的區別。標準版本能夠處理大多數的網路服務。但是如果需要實現群集或這目錄聯合等相關服務時,標準版本就沒有辦法。此時必須要有企業版出馬,來承擔這個角色。

  二是需要注意,雖然企業版本能夠提供大規模的處理能力和內存能力。也就是說,通常情況下對於中小企業的SQLServer等應用,企業版本是沒有問題的。要實現SQLServer群集服務企業版本也能夠勝任。但是如果數量比較大,則企業版本處理起來也會有一定的壓力。通常情況下,如果需要進行大規模的數據分析(如需要建議數據倉庫),筆者還是建議採用數據中心版本。
三、數據中心版。

  數據中心版,顧名思義,這個版本能夠支持超大規模數據中心操作的高端硬體版本的操作系統。以2008版本為例,這個數據中心版能夠最多支持8個核心處理器。微軟推出這個數據中心版,其主要面對的對象是需要上擴伺服器技術以便在一個或者有限數量的伺服器群集上支持大型集中式數據倉庫的機構。簡單的說,就是需要通過數據倉庫來分析數據、並且數據量特別大的企業。像一些大型企業的BI系統,就需要使用建立在數據中心版本之上的數據倉庫。

  在這裡,筆者認為各位讀者有必要掌握兩個基本的名次:外擴和上擴。外擴是指將應用程序分佈在多個伺服器上一邊獲得更好的性能。簡單的說就好像是實現伺服器均衡。而上擴是指將多個處理器添加到單個系統上以提升應用程序的性能。簡單的說,就是不增加伺服器的數量,而只是增加伺服器的處理器的數量,以改善伺服器的性能。筆者一般推薦的是,先上擴,然後再外擴。因為從維護與成本的角度來看,增加核心處理器的數量並不會增加維護的成本。而且與配置一台伺服器而言,增加一個核心處理器的成本要低廉的多。通常情況下,只有在伺服器的核心處理器數量已經到達極限或者出於高可用性等原因(如需要使用一個輔助伺服器來提高高可用性,此時可以順帶實現伺服器的負載均衡),才考慮選擇外擴的方案。

  從應用程序的角度來看,筆者認為,對於Web等應用服務來說,外擴方案是首選的方案。而對於數據倉庫等應用程序來說,上擴則是比較理智的選擇。雖然外擴也可以改善數據倉庫伺服器的性能,但是收益並沒有上擴方案那麼大。畢竟外擴方案的話,還需要考慮到帶寬的約束。為此對於數據倉庫等類似的應用程序來說,數據中心版本可以提供更好的集中式可擴充性能,以及額外的容錯和故障恢復能力。不過這裡需要注意的是,數據中ixnban不嫩購單獨購買。其一般都是通過專用硬體一同出售。因為數據中心版需要由硬體供應商協會開發和測試,具有嚴格的性能、可靠性和可支持性的標準。

  四、WebServer伺服器版本。

  WebServer伺服器這個版本比較特殊,其主要是針對WebServer這個應用服務而設計的。簡單的說,這個版本就是Web前端伺服器操作系統,主要用來滿足於Web服務需要的應用伺服器需求。通常情況下,IIS、郵件等應用服務部署在這個版本上比較合適。因為在部署這個伺服器版本時,已經針對這些應用服務,對操作系統進行了一定的配置。如此的話,就可以減少伺服器操作系統安裝完成後的配置工作。

  如前段時間,有一家企業需要購買一個伺服器操作系統,主要用於Web服務(包括IIS伺服器以及相關的腳本開發與測試),筆者就建議他們採用WebServer伺服器版本。相對其他版本來說,這個價格比較便宜,而且對於硬體的要求也不是很高。特別適用於Web類型的服務。

  不過需要注意的是,一般不建議在WebServer伺服器版本上實現諸如列印伺服器或者DNS、DHCP等應用服務。因為Web版本根本沒有提供這方面的服務。如果需要的話,用戶還必須購買其他的版本,如標準版本或者企業版本。這樣的話,就可能有點重複投資。如果有這種情況的話,還不如一開始就購買伺服器版本或者標準版本。只是在性能優化上,可能對管理員提出了比較高的要求。

  五、伺服器核心版。

  從80年代就開始接觸電腦的用戶來說,會有這方面的感覺。硬體的性能越好,但是對於用戶來說並沒有感覺速度有明顯的變化。這其中很重要的一個原因是,操作系統本身對消耗硬體的資源程度就在不斷的增加。如剛開始出現的Dos操作系統,由於其沒有圖形化的界面,為此雖然硬體參數不高,但是跑起來仍然相當的快。伺服器核心版就是根據這個原理來設計的。

  簡單的說,伺服器核心版與其他版本相比,就是沒有圖形化的界面。呈現在用戶面前的就是一個Dos操作界面。如此的話,就可以減少對硬體資源的消耗。從而提高應用程序的性能。如果將操作系統當作伺服器來用,筆者推薦使用伺服器核心版本。伺服器核心版本其實並不是一個獨立的版本,它是一個附屬版本,或者說是各個版本的一個安裝選項。在安裝時,系統管理員可以根據自己的需求,選擇這個選項。如果選中的話,則在安裝過程中,安裝進程並不會安裝圖形化界面。這跟Linux等伺服器操作系統比較類似。一般來說,如果是用於生產的伺服器,採用伺服器核心版本為好。如果用於測試的,出於方便的考慮,可以採用企業版本或者標準版本。當然,命令行的操作會提高操作者的難度。

  這裡需要特別提醒的是,伺服器核心版本由於是各個版本的附屬品。也就是說,其可以跟分為標準版、企業版、數據中心版與WebServer版。其主要的不同就在於沒有圖形化管理的界面。在選擇時,仍然需要遵循上面的規則
很多時候解釋是不必要的——敵人不相信你的解釋,朋友不需要你的 解釋


好貼與你分享。謝謝您的回帖
您需要登錄后才可以回帖 登錄 | 註冊

本版積分規則

關於本站 | 隱私權政策 | 免責條款 | 版權聲明 | 聯絡我們

Copyright © 2001-2013 海外華人中文門戶:倍可親 (http://big5.backchina.com) All Rights Reserved.

程序系統基於 Discuz! X3.1 商業版 優化 Discuz! © 2001-2013 Comsenz Inc.

本站時間採用京港台時間 GMT+8, 2025-8-10 09:59

快速回復 返回頂部 返回列表